Pixel Sprite-Sheet Template

Several small blank grids on one page.

The Pixel Sprite-Sheet Template packs several small blank grids onto a single printable page, mirroring the layout professional game developers use to store character animations and object variations. Students in grades 3–8 use each mini-grid to draw a different pose, expression, or direction of the same character — front, side, back, jumping, walking — creating a personal sprite sheet just like the ones inside real video games. Teachers use this template in art and technology classes to introduce animation principles: how small, incremental changes between frames create the illusion of movement. Because all grids share the same dimensions, students can cut out individual frames and flip through them like a flipbook, or scan the sheet to bring characters into simple game-design tools. The compact layout makes efficient use of one sheet of paper while accommodating a full character study.

Learning objectives

  • Understand how sprite sheets organize character poses and animation frames
  • Design a consistent character across multiple poses or directions
  • Practice incremental drawing changes to suggest movement or emotion
  • Develop spatial economy by working within small, fixed-size grids
  • Introduce game-design and digital-art vocabulary in a hands-on way
  • Build sequencing skills by ordering frames to tell a visual story

How to use this template

  1. Download and print the sprite-sheet PDF on standard paper; one page typically holds 6–12 mini grids depending on the template variant.
  2. Decide on a character or object and sketch a base pose in the first grid using pencil before adding color.
  3. Use subsequent grids to draw alternate poses — walking cycle, attack pose, idle animation — keeping proportions consistent across frames.
  4. Color each frame with colored pencils or fine-tip markers, then outline with a thin black pen for crisp edges.
  5. Label each frame below the grid (e.g., 'walk 1', 'walk 2', 'jump') and cut apart if creating a physical flipbook or stop-motion sequence.

Classroom & home ideas

  • Flipbook animation: students cut out a row of frames, stack them in order, and staple the left edge to create a mini flipbook that plays back their character's walk cycle.
  • Game-design unit: pair the sprite sheet with a simple grid map template so students can design both the playable character and the world it moves through.
  • Emotion study: ask students to draw the same character expressing six different emotions — one per frame — and discuss how pixel placement changes the perceived feeling.
  • Before-and-after comparison: students draw a character in a 'day' palette on the top row and a 'night' palette on the bottom row, exploring how color shifts mood.
  • Collaborative game: groups each design one character on their sprite sheet; swap sheets and vote on which character would win in a game based on design alone.

Frequently asked questions

How many grids are on one sprite-sheet page?

The standard layout provides 6 to 12 small grids per page, arranged in a 2- or 3-column layout. This accommodates a basic 4-frame walk cycle plus additional poses within a single printed sheet.

What grid size are the individual frames on the sprite sheet?

Each frame is typically an 8×8 or 16×16 grid, scaled to fit multiple frames on one letter-size page. The consistent cell size across all frames makes it easy to maintain character proportions.

Can students scan this template to bring their sprites into a game or animation program?

Yes. Scanning at 300 dpi produces a clean image. Many free pixel-art editors (like Piskel or PixilArt) accept scanned images as references, and the uniform grid spacing makes it straightforward to digitize each frame.

Is this suitable for a single-lesson activity or a longer project?

Both work. A single lesson is enough to complete one or two frames as an introduction. For a unit project, students design a full walk cycle or four-direction set across several class periods, building complexity gradually.
